Also water leaves debris on side of the engine causing clogged blockage due to dirty residues in water and rust as well. Any cheap coolant like abro red is fine if he can't afford costly once.
Using the wrong coolant is worse than using water.
I'd advise he goes with the manufacturer spec with the right mixture.

The first thing is make sure the coz of your problem is the radiator... if is the radiator issue and not engine problem.. Fix the radiator and flush out the water very well o .. Than you start afresh with coolant.. Once you put coolant than you are good to go ,no need to top anything again o . The coolant will be good for years to come . Just make sure you use the correct stuff. The coolant will product your engine for years to come. This job needs to done by a specialist ,not a do it yourself YouTube type thing o .. Let a specialist handle it o .. You can take it to Radauto or Gazzuzz ... so that proper diagnosis can be done ... At the end of the day .. The facts remain that you need coolant not water in your radiator...
